Condividi tramite


Proprietà SqlCeParameter.Value

Ottiene o imposta il valore del parametro.

Spazio dei nomi  System.Data.SqlServerCe
Assembly:  System.Data.SqlServerCe (in System.Data.SqlServerCe.dll)

Sintassi

'Dichiarazione
Public Overrides Property Value As Object
    Get
    Set
'Utilizzo
Dim instance As SqlCeParameter
Dim value As Object

value = instance.Value

instance.Value = value
public override Object Value { get; set; }
public:
virtual property Object^ Value {
    Object^ get () override;
    void set (Object^ value) override;
}
abstract Value : Object with get, set
override Value : Object with get, set
override function get Value () : Object
override function set Value (value : Object)

Valore proprietà

Tipo: System.Object
Oggetto Object che rappresenta il valore del parametro. Il valore predefinito è nullriferimento Null (Nothing in Visual Basic)..

Implementa

IDataParameter.Value

Osservazioni

Il valore è associato all'oggetto SqlCeCommand inviato al server.

Quando si invia un valore di parametro null al server, è necessario specificare DBNull anziché nullriferimento Null (Nothing in Visual Basic)., che corrisponde a un oggetto vuoto senza valore. DBNull viene utilizzato per rappresentare valori null.

Se nell'applicazione viene specificato il tipo di database, il valore associato verrà convertito nel tipo specifico quando il provider inviati dati al server. Il provider tenta di convertire qualsiasi tipo di valore se supporta l'interfaccia IConvertible. Se il tipo specificato non è compatibile con il valore, potranno verificarsi errori di conversione.

Entrambe le proprietà DbType e SqlDbType possono essere dedotte mediante l'impostazione della proprietà Value.

La proprietà Value viene sovrascritta dal metodo Update.

Esempi

Nell'esempio riportato di seguito viene creato un oggetto SqlCeParameter e viene impostata la relativa proprietà Value.

Dim param As New SqlCeParameter("@Description", SqlDbType.NVarChar)
param.Value = "garden hose"
SqlCeParameter param = new SqlCeParameter("@Description", SqlDbType.NVarChar);
param.Value = "garden hose";

Vedere anche

Riferimento

SqlCeParameter Classe

Spazio dei nomi System.Data.SqlServerCe

SqlDbType

DbType